edema
(eh-deem-uh)
:
build-up of fluid in the tissues, causing swelling. Edema of the arm can occur after radical mastectomy, axillary dissection of lymph nodes, or radiation therapy. See also, lymphedema.
ejaculate
:
to release semen during orgasm; as a noun, semen.
electrofulguration
:
a type of treatment that destroys cancer cells by burning with an electrical current.

emesis
(em-eh-sis)
:
vomiting
endocrine glands
(en-do-krin glands)
:
glands that release hormones into the bloodstream. The ovaries are one type of endocrine gland.
endocrine therapy
:
manipulation of hormones in order to treat a disease or condition. See also, hormone therapy.
endocrinologist
(en-do-krin-ol-o-jist)
:
a doctor who specializes in diseases related to the glands of the endocrine system, e.g., the thyroid, pancreas, and adrenal glands.
endometrium
(en-do-mee-tree-um)
:
the lining of the womb (uterus).
endoscopy
(en-dos-ko-pee)
:
inspection of body organs or cavities using a flexible, lighted tube called an endoscope.
